Problem 2

Solved on 2/29/2008

Each new term in the Fibonacci sequence is generated by adding the previous two terms. By starting with 1 and 2, the first 10 terms will be:

1, 2, 3, 5, 8, 13, 21, 34, 55, 89, ...

Find the sum of all the even-valued terms in the sequence which do not exceed one million.

$pn = 1;
$pn2 = 0;
$answer = 0;
for($c = 1; $c < 1000000; $c=$pn+$pn2 ) {
  if(($c % 2) == 0 && $c < 1000000) $answer += $c;
  $pn2 = $pn;
  $pn = $c;
}
$answer = 1,089,154
